I have a 04' ZX-6R and have only had it for about two months now. I was just wondering about the oil change cycle and lube cycle of the street bikes. If there are monthly should do's and winter to do's. I will be storing it in my insulated garage that stays around 50's-60's in the winter. I have a cover for it and I want to know what other stuff I should buy for maintenance and storage.
Any help welcome, I know cars like the back of my hand but bikes are still new to me. And I do not want to screw up my bike because I did not know to do something.

i change my oil every 3,000 miles, always use a new filter myself, usually the book will say to replace it every other change so thats up to you... people say to clean/lube your chain every 500 miles but i just don't have the time, i do it about twice an oil change so every 1,500 i give it a good cleaning and spray on new chain lube, but just as important is making sure it stays in adjustment... if its an 04 thats about it i'd say, i'm just going by suzuki recommendations but for the most part a bike is a bike, check the air filter around 10k, spark plugs at 7,500, change the coolant and brake fluid every 2 years... as far as winterization i wouldn't do anything, our winters are so short and mild, add to that the occasional 60 degree day where you can pull it out and ride and then yours being insulated you should be fine

just park it and turn off the gas if its going to be sitting for a while. Try and take it for a 5-10 minute spin and get it up to operating temp once a month if possible.

I just put my bike in the basement up on the stands, wash it and seal/polish it, put some fuel stabilizer in the tank, and drain the oil and put in cheapo whatever oil for the winter months..

A battery tender and fuel stabilizer are the things you really need. Having fresh oil in it is nice too.
